Shyster as a Noun

Definitions of "Shyster" as a noun

According to the Oxford Dictionary of English, “shyster” as a noun can have the following definitions:

  • A person (especially a lawyer or politician) who uses unscrupulous or unethical methods.
  • A person, especially a lawyer, who uses unscrupulous, fraudulent, or deceptive methods in business.
